Softball at Beijing 2008
Softball at the 2008 Summer Olympics in Beijing will be held over a ten day period starting August 12 and culminating with the medal finals on August 21. All games will be played at the Fengtai Softball Field. The International Olympic Committee has voted to remove softball from the program for the 2012 Olympics, so this is the last time that softball will be contested at the Olympics unless it is reinstated at a future date.
Eight teams will compete in the Olympic softball tournament, and the competition consists of two rounds. The preliminary round follows a round robin format, where each of the teams plays all the other teams once. Following this, the top four teams advance to a single elimination round consisting of two semi final games, and finally the bronze and gold medal games.
The eight teams in the Olympic softball tournament will qualify through a series of tournaments. China, as the host nation, is guaranteed one automatic entry. The top four finishers at the 2006 Softball World Championships will be qualified for the Olympic tournament. Finally, there will be continental qualifying tournaments for Europe/Africa, Pan-America, and Asia/Oceania, with the winners of each tournament earning a spot in the Olympic tournament.
